Cracked foundation repair services focus on identifying and fixing issues related to cracks, settling, or shifting in a building’s foundation. These services typically involve assessing the extent of the damage, stabilizing the foundation, and implementing solutions such as underpinning, piering, or sealing cracks. The goal is to restore structural integrity, prevent further damage, and improve the safety of the property. Professionals use specialized techniques and equipment to ensure that repairs are effective and durable, helping property owners maintain the stability of their buildings.
Foundation problems often arise from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ction, leading to cracks and uneven settling. These issues can cause doors and windows to stick, uneven floors, or visible cracks in walls and the foundation itself. Addressing foundation cracks early can prevent more serious structural damage and costly repairs down the line. Local contractors experienced in foundation repair can diagnose the root causes of these issues and recommend appropriate solutions to stabilize and reinforce the structure.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for cracked fo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ods. For example, minor cracks might cost around $2,000, while extensive repairs could reach $7,500 or more.
Labor and Materials - The cost of labor and materials usually accounts for a significant portion of the total, with prices varying based on the project's complexity. On average, local pros may charge between $50 and $150 per hour for repair work.
Type of Repair - Different repair techniques, such as epoxy injections or underpinning, influence costs. Epoxy repairs might cost approximately $1,000 to $3,000, whereas underpinning can range from $3,000 to $10,000 or higher.
Additional Factors - Factors like foundation size, accessibility, and geographic location can impact costs. For example, repairs in Owings, MD, may typically fall within a certain range, but prices can vary based on specific site conditions.

What are common signs of a foundation in need of repair?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How long does a typical foundation repair process take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week by local service providers.
Are there different types of foundation repair methods? Yes, options include slabjacking, piering, underpinning, and wall reinforcement, selected based on the specific foundation issues.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; a profess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ed or if monitoring is sufficient.
